Mazda Mazda6

Fri, 27 Jul 2012

Mazda has revealed that it will unveil its new 2014 Mazda6 sedan, the second model bearing its new generation design language following on from the CX-5 crossover., at the Moscow motor show on 29 August. Although very few details have been released, it's clear from these teaser images that it's closely related to last year's Takeri concept car in terms of both surfacing and graphics. The car, designed under the new KODO ‘Soul of Motion' design language, incorporates the full range of SKYACTIV technologies.

Bentley SUV confirmed? Maybe

Fri, 15 Jul 2011

Bentley are planning an SUV There was a time, not too long ago, when there was a reasonable expectation that most car makers would, at some point, deliver up an SUV. Yes, there was even talk of a Bentley SUV. But the global meltdown and the global-warmists seemed to have put paid to the concept of an off-road luxury everything, so we all forgot about the SUV plans gathering dust in every car designer’s cupboard.
